Logicists maps can be used for this purposes, as they only need to know the current state.
"cat map" on the other hand requires 2D arrays. In theory you could create a 2D array of encryption information, and then keep a 2d state variable that reflected your current virtual position in the array, moving between the positions according to cat map.

Well, that File Exchange contribution cannot itself be used to encrypt or encode anything. However you can make use of the fundamental equation
x(i)=r*x(i-1)*(1-x(i-1));
The question you would have would be "given that a chaotic floating point sequence can be created, how would you use that to encrypt or encode a bit stream?
